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 4 and 30 is 60
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 60 - For the 1st fraction, since 4 × 15 = 60,
16/4 = 16 × 15/4 × 15 = 240/60 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 30 × 2 = 60,
12/30 = 12 × 2/30 × 2 = 24/60 - Add the two like fractions:
240/60 + 24/60 = 240 + 24/60 = 264/60 - 264/60 simplified gives 22/5
- So, 16/4 + 12/30 = 22/5
